About 2a
2a is a two-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Chiseldon, Swindon, Swindon (SN4 0LJ). It has a recorded floor area of 57 m² (around 614 sq ft) and construction records dating it to before 1900. The latest certificate (August 2023) shows a C (score 78), near the top of the C band. When first surveyed in July 2013 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or, window efficiency went from Average to Good and h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 81).
At 57 m² it sits well below the postcode median (86 m² across 7 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 86% of similar EPCs). Across 2019–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 12.3%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£269/sq ft) was about 35.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old August 2022 for £165,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
